Abstract
Concordance analysis was performed to identify the best post-dose T assay time-point to guide any necessary dose-adjustment in oral TU patients. Concordance is defined herein to describe the extent of agreement between a decision to adjust the oral TU dose (up or down) when a single circulating T concentration in remains in the hypogonadal range [i.e., <252 ng/dl (9 nmol/L) for this study] or supraphysiological range [i.e., >907 ng/dL (31 nmol/L)] and the desired outcome of that decision (i.e., a circulating T level in the eugonadal range) is achieved.
